The Order of the Holy Trinity was a 12th century Catholic religious order to redeem Christian captives taken as prisoners during the wars between Christians and Muslims. It was also known as the Trinitarians and was distinguished by the white cross its members wore on their habits.

The Order of the Holy Trinity helped the Crusaders during the Crusades. The order's main objective was to assist Christian prisoners of war captured by the Muslim forces. The Trinitarians would negotiate with the captors to secure the release of these prisoners by offering ransom or exchange. In some cases, they would even offer themselves as hostages in exchange for the release of Christian prisoners.

The Trinitarians also established priories and monasteries throughout Europe and the Holy Land. These priories served as sanctuaries for Christian pilgrims and refugees. They provided food, shelter, and protection to the Crusaders traveling to the Holy Land. They also offered medical care to the wounded soldiers.

Cesar Chavez, a Mexican American labor leader and civil rights activist, founded the National Farm Workers Association (NFWA) in 1962.

He worked tirelessly to improve the working conditions and wages of farmworkers, who were predominantly Latino, African American, and Filipino.

Through nonviolent protests, strikes, and boycotts, Chavez and the NFWA succeeded in bringing attention to the struggles of farmworkers and securing collective bargaining rights for them.

In 1966, the NFWA merged with the Agricultural Workers Organizing Committee to form the United Farm Workers (UFW), which became a powerful force in the American labor movement.

The English Lollards were the lay followers and successors of the late medieval theologian John Wycliffe. Wycliffe was a prominent theologian and philosopher who criticized the Catholic Church and its practices.

He believed that the Church should return to its earlier simplicity and that the Bible should be available in the vernacular language so that the people could read and interpret it for themselves. Wycliffe's ideas influenced many people, and his followers, known as Lollards, continued to spread his teachings even after his death. The Lollards were persecuted by the Catholic Church and the English monarchy for their beliefs, but their ideas continued to influence religious and political thought in England and beyond.

Montesquieu's writings had a significant influence on the formation of the U.S. Constitution.

Montesquieu was a French philosopher who believed in the separation of powers and the importance of checks and balances in government.

In his book, "The Spirit of Laws," he argued that a government should be divided into three branches: the legislative, the executive, and the judicial, with each branch having a distinct function and limiting the power of the others.
This idea of separation of powers was incorporated into the U.S. Constitution.

The Constitution established the three branches of government and provided each with specific powers and responsibilities.

The legislative branch is responsible for making laws, the executive branch is responsible for enforcing laws, and the judicial branch is responsible for interpreting laws.
Additionally, Montesquieu's idea of checks and balances was also incorporated into the U.S. Constitution.

The Constitution established a system of checks and balances where each branch of government has the ability to limit the power of the other two branches.

For example, the president can veto a law passed by Congress, but Congress can override the veto with a two-thirds majority vote.

The Supreme Court can declare a law unconstitutional, limiting the power of the legislative branch.

The Sixteenth Amendment, ratified in 1913, allows the federal government to collect income tax without apportioning it among the states. This amendment provided the government with a significant source of revenue, which enabled it to expand its programs and influence.

The Seventeenth Amendment, also ratified in 1913, changed the way U.S. Senators are elected. Previously, Senators were chosen by state legislatures, which allowed for a greater balance of power between the federal government and state governments. The Seventeenth Amendment provides for the direct election of Senators by the people, which has arguably led to a more centralized federal government and weakened state influence.

The movie legend who donated the profit from the sale of his salad dressings to charity is Paul Newman.

He was a well-known American actor, director, and philanthropist who established Newman's Own in 1982, a company that produces food products such as salad dressings, sauces, and snacks. Newman pledged to donate all of the company's after-tax profits to charity, and by 2018, Newman's Own had donated over $550 million to various charities worldwide. Newman's charitable donations and philanthropic work have made him an inspirational figure for many people.

Paul Newman's philanthropic work did not stop with his food company. He also founded the Hole in the Wall Gang Camp in 1988, a summer camp for seriously ill children. The camp provides children with a fun, safe, and supportive environment, allowing them to experience the joys of childhood despite their illnesses.  Paul Newman's legacy as a philanthropist and humanitarian continues to inspire people worldwide to make a difference in the lives of others.
